Geriatric Internal Medicine is a medical specialty that enables patients to manage natural aging life stages by preventing and treating age-related conditions, and preserving patients' independence and quality of life. Significant diseases and conditions treated by Geriatric Internal Medicine Doctors include nutrition deficiencies, hormone imbalances, psychological issues, medication side effects, incontinence, heart disease, epilepsy, osteoporosis, fall injuries, frailty, strokes, Alzheimer's Disease, and cancer.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Geriatric Internal Medicine Doctors include standard preventative wellness screenings and treatments, nutrition counseling, psychological counseling, lifestyle interventions, post-fall rehabilitation, living accomodation transition, and nursing home care.

An internist who has special knowledge of the aging process and special skills in the diagnostic, therapeutic, preventive and rehabilitative aspects of illness in the elderly. This specialist cares for geriatric patients in the patient's home, the office, long-term care settings such as nursing homes and the hospital.

Internists specialize in puzzling medical problems and in the ongoing care of chronic illnesses. Internists also specialize in preventing disease by promoting health, and are trained to manage multisystem disease conditions that single-organ-disease specialists may not be trained to address. Internal Medicine is a medical specialty focused on study, prevention, ass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of short and long term multi-organ conditions. Significant diseases and conditions treated by Internal Medicine Doctors include cold and flu, heart disease, hypertension, diabetes, obesity, and chronic lung disease. Internists generally act as personal physicians and often develop long-term relationships with their patients.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Internal Medicine Doctors include medical history reviews, physical exams, blood tests, scans, and other diagnostic tests, as well as specialist referrals. Internists may choose to practice only in the hospital, only in an outpatient clinic, or in both.

A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.
